Director of Housing and Residence Life

The Director of Housing and Residence Life provides leadership and vision for the residential experience at Chicago State University. This role oversees all aspects of housing operations, staff development, student engagement, and community building within the residence halls. The Director works to create a safe, inclusive, and supportive environment where students can thrive academically, socially, and personally.

Assistant Director of Housing and Residence Life

The Assistant Director supports the overall management of Housing and Residence Life by assisting with supervision of staff, student development initiatives, and daily operations of the residence halls. This role helps implement departmental goals, supports student success, and serves as a key partner in enhancing the residential experience.

Graduate Assistant for Programming (GA)

The Graduate Assistant for Programming supports Housing and Residence Life by planning and coordinating events that foster student engagement and community development. The GA works closely with student staff to create programs that are educational, inclusive, and fun, while also helping with training, leadership development, and assessment of programs. This role ensures residents have meaningful opportunities to connect, learn, and thrive outside the classroom.

Assistant Residence Coordinators

Assistant Residence Coordinators (ARCs) are graduate assistants who support the operations of Housing and Residence Life. They work closely with professional staff to assist with resident support, community development, crisis response, programming, and administrative functions that contribute to a positive residential experience.

Community Desk Assistants (CDAs)

Community Desk Assistants are the first point of contact at the residence hall front desks. They help create a welcoming environment by greeting residents and guests, answering questions, monitoring building access, and assisting with administrative tasks. CDAs play a vital role in maintaining safety and providing customer service to support the daily operations of the residence halls.
